Hello everyone, another question about standards: what are the differences between normal type P, intrinsically safe type B/i, and flameproof type B/d?
Reply #22009-02-19
The on-site environment imposes different requirements on instruments, necessitating the selection of different types. If there is a risk of explosion, use an explosion-proof type; if it is necessary to prevent sparks from reaching dangerous areas, use this type; if no such requirements exist, the ordinary type is the cheapest option: lol :lol
